Catalog description

Theory and method in undergraduate instruction in psychology. Weekly meetings with faculty sponsor and supervised experience which may include administering and developing examinations, proctoring self-paced instructional units, course development, discussion group leadership, and in-depth directed readings of relevant topics. Offered on a credit/no credit basis only. Students seeking to register for this course should obtain the correct form from the Applied Experience Coordinator or from the Psychology Department Office. May be repeated for credit up to a maximum of 9 units.
